ZIP 26337 and ZIP 26343 are ZIP Code areas in West Virginia.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

ZIP 26337 has the higher population (842 vs 297 in ZIP 26343). ZIP 26337 has the higher median household income ($50,556 vs $39,922 in ZIP 26343). Since 2019, ZIP 26343's population has grown faster (+18.8% vs -38.5%).
